About the role

Deliver comprehensive dental care to patients within a high-caliber multi-dentist practice. Collaborate with other general dentists and specialists to provide exceptional patient outcomes.

Are you a patient-focused General Dentist who is looking for a part-time position at a high-caliber multi-dentist practice? At our practice located in Riverhead, NY, we are offering a $20,000 Sign-On Bonus, and we’re dedicated to providing exceptional care in a welcoming environment that our patients love to visit. We’re seeking a General Dentist to deliver comprehensive care — while being supported by a skilled team and state-of-the-art technology.

What We Offer

Stellar compensation structure $20,000 Sign-On Bonus Comprehensive benefits: Health Insurance, 401(k) with company match, and malpractice insurance reimbursement Collaboration with experienced General Dentists and Specialists Ongoing CE opportunities to expand your scope of practice Modern office with a collaborative, experienced support staff What You Bring: DDS/DMD and active NY dental license Strong clinical and communication skills Enthusiasm for learning and delivering outstanding patient care Apply today and take the next step in a rewarding career with us!

Requirements

Candidates must possess a DDS/DMD degree and an active New York dental license. Strong clinical skills and a commitment to outstanding patient care are required.

Market context

New York dentist roles favor experienced clinicians

In New York, dentist openings often draw interest from practices seeking clinicians who can diagnose accurately, plan comprehensive treatment, and keep a productive schedule moving independently. This role is competitive because it calls for a DDS or DMD from an accredited U.S. dental school, an active NY dental license, and at least two years of clinical experience.
